The Finger Vein Recognition Smart Lock Market is witnessing significant growth due to increasing demand for advanced security solutions across various sectors. These locks use the unique patterns of an individual's finger veins to verify identity, offering high levels of security and convenience. The technology is gaining traction because it provides a superior alternative to traditional biometric systems like fingerprint recognition, offering enhanced accuracy and difficulty in replication or spoofing. As more businesses and residential properties prioritize safety and ease of access, the demand for finger vein recognition smart locks is poised to expand across a variety of applications. Residential Segment Description:
The residential application of finger vein recognition smart locks is one of the most significant growth drivers in the market. Homeowners are increasingly adopting these locks to enhance the security of their properties while also offering convenience for accessing doors without the need for traditional keys or PINs. The technology provides a high level of protection, as each individual’s finger vein pattern is unique, making it nearly impossible to replicate or steal. This offers an additional layer of security over conventional locks, especially in a world where identity theft and break-ins are becoming more prevalent. Furthermore, the ease of use and the growing trend of smart homes contribute to the increasing popularity of these devices in residential settings.With the advent of the Internet of Things (IoT) and home automation, finger vein recognition smart locks are being integrated with other smart home devices like alarms, cameras, and lighting systems. This integration enables homeowners to create a fully automated and secure environment, accessible remotely through smartphones or other connected devices. The market is expected to continue growing in the residential sector due to the rising demand for personalized and secure home automation systems. The ability to remotely grant or revoke access further enhances the appeal of these systems for homeowners who desire both safety and convenience.
Commercial Segment Description:
In the commercial sector, finger vein recognition smart locks are gaining traction in offices, industrial facilities, and other business establishments as a means to enhance security and streamline access control. The commercial application of these smart locks is particularly beneficial in environments that require high-security measures, such as government buildings, research labs, data centers, and financial institutions. By using finger vein technology, businesses can ensure that only authorized personnel are granted access to sensitive areas, mitigating the risks of unauthorized entry and data breaches. Additionally, these systems are more reliable than traditional keycards or passwords, which can be lost, stolen, or shared among unauthorized individuals.Another advantage of finger vein recognition smart locks in commercial settings is their scalability. These systems can be integrated with existing access control systems to provide a seamless security solution across multiple entry points within a building or campus. Businesses can also track and monitor access logs, improving accountability and security management. With an increasing number of organizations prioritizing workplace security and efficient access management, the demand for finger vein recognition technology in commercial settings is anticipated to grow steadily over the forecast period.

1. What is a finger vein recognition smart lock?
A finger vein recognition smart lock uses the unique vein pattern in a person’s finger to authenticate their identity, providing secure and keyless access to doors.
2. How does a finger vein recognition smart lock work?
It uses near-infrared light to scan the veins in a person’s finger and matches the pattern with pre-recorded data to grant access.
3. Are finger vein recognition smart locks secure?
Yes, finger vein recognition is one of the most secure biometric authentication methods, as it is extremely difficult to replicate or forge a person’s vein pattern.
